The D.MAS (Diploma in Minimal Access Surgery) January 2026 Feedback & Convocation Ceremony at World Laparoscopy Hospital (WLH) marked a memorable academic milestone for surgeons from across the globe. The event reflected not only the successful completion of rigorous laparoscopic training but also the hospital’s continued commitment to excellence in minimally invasive surgical education. The D.MAS program at World Laparoscopy Hospital is internationally recognized for its structured curriculum, combining strong theoretical foundations with intensive hands-on training. During the January 2026 batch, participants were exposed to advanced laparoscopic techniques, simulation-based learning, live surgeries, and evidence-based clinical discussions. This comprehensive approach enabled surgeons to refine their skills, enhance precision, and adopt safer surgical practices aligned with global standards of minimal access surgery.
